Barnet vs Shrewsbury prediction

Barnet were very impressive as they won the National League last season, and many tipped them up to do well in League Two. The Bees started the season with four successive defeats across all competitions, but they have since now collected seven points from their last three matches.

They now face a Shrewsbury Town side that have a squad that does not appear to be well suited to the style of football wanted to be played by Michael Appleton. Salop have been woeful at the start of this season with just two points collected from their opening six games as they sit firmly in the bottom two ahead of this match day.

These two sides were two divisions apart last season with Shrewsbury coming down from League One, but it would be a major surprise to see anything other than last year’s non-league winners coming out on top here.
